Jyotimoy
Jyotimoy is a unique and luminous name of Indian origin, translating to ‘one who is full of light’ or ‘radiant’. It is primarily used as a masculine name and holds significant meaning in Hindu culture. In various Indian languages, 'jyoti' refers to light or brightness, while 'moy' implies fullness or existence. The name symbolizes enlightenment, wisdom, and positive energy.
